Ukraine Accuses Russia of Mass Executions of POWs

Ukraine accuses Russia of mass executions of prisoners of war in the Donetsk region. Ukrainian prosecutors allege that Russian soldiers executed two Ukrainian soldiers after capturing them, with one being executed while naked. Kyiv authorities claim these actions constitute war crimes and violations of the Geneva Convention. Several similar cases have been recorded in the past, with Ukraine continuing to insist on its accusations of inhumane treatment of prisoners of war by the Russian army. The situation further exacerbates the already tense relations between the two countries.
